When you buy a vehicle in India, it is absolutely crucial to register it in the Regional Transport Office (RTO) to get a registration certificate. Driving a car or riding a two-wheeler without a valid RC is against the law and a punishable offence. So if you live in Bhopal city, registering your vehicle at Bhopal RTO is mandatory under the Motor Vehicles Act, 1988. Talking about MP-04 RTO, it performs many vital functions and duties on a daily basis.
Conducting driving tests for LL & DL, issuing new DL & RC, transferring vehicle ownership, issuing fitness certificate & special permit, and collecting road tax are some of the main functions of the Bhopal RTO. Bhopal RTO is governed by the Central Motor Vehicles Act, 1988, and the Madhya Pradesh Motor Vehicle Rules, 1994. The RTO office is entrusted with implementing the rules and regulations and ensuring a regulated and safe transport system. Therefore, the Bhopal RTO is empowered to provide various vehicle-related services to the citizens. They broadly include licences, registration, permits, tax collection, and above all, ensure road safety and control vehicular pollution. In addition, the RTO is on the national “Parivahan” grid, rolling out online services in uniformity with other states and union territories.

It is not only the vehicle’s antecedents that determine the payable premium, but the RTO location is equally vital. It is a little-known fact that vehicles registered in the districts pay a lower premium than their city counterparts, despite identical parameters. The crucial assumption that lowers the premium is the lesser peril on the district roads than in cities due to the vast difference in traffic volume.
Your vehicle purchase is incomplete without registration at the relevant Bhopal RTO in your vicinity. The MV Act prohibits unregistered vehicles on Indian roads regardless of new or old. Hence, the dealer or the car showroom does the necessary legwork on your behalf for new vehicles.
Temporary Registration: The dealer registers a new vehicle temporarily while selling to the prospective buyer. The temporary registration is usually valid for one month, within which the sold vehicle must be registered permanently at the Bhopal RTO.

The first step is to obtain a proper driving licence by applying for the learner’s licence. It is issued with six months validity after passing the online evaluation conducted at the Bhopal RTO office. First, however, you must fix an appointment for a driving test and obtain the permanent licence before the learner’s licence expires.
